I took my car in at aroud 33,000 miles to have some things looked (squeeks and such) being as the warranty was going to expire. I told them that I had noticed that I was smelling clutch burn quite often when I gave her some extra gas to do something like scoot across an intersection or something. I would smell it even though I wouldn't spin the tires or anything. My service rep at the dealership said that being as most of my miles were highway (94 miles round trip to work) and the fact that is was engaging kinda' high up on the pedal travel, they were going to replace my clutch, pressure plate, and release berring under warranty. I was stoked to hear that....especially as the clutch is usuanlly a non-warranty part. I get her back today in a couple of hours Jim
